Document the clock properties required by the spi-atmel driver.

Signed-off-by: Boris BREZILLON <b.brezillon@overkiz.com>
---
 .../devicetree/bindings/spi/spi_atmel.txt          |    5 +++++
 1 file changed, 5 insertions(+)

diff --git a/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/spi/spi_atmel.txt b/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/spi/spi_atmel.txt
index 07e04cd..4f8184d 100644
--- a/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/spi/spi_atmel.txt
+++ b/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/spi/spi_atmel.txt
@@ -5,6 +5,9 @@ Required properties:
 - reg: Address and length of the register set for the device
 - interrupts: Should contain spi interrupt
 - cs-gpios: chipselects
+- clock-names: tuple listing input clock names.
+	Required elements: "spi_clk"
+- clocks: phandles to input clocks.
 
 Example:
 
@@ -14,6 +17,8 @@ spi1: spi@fffcc000 {
 	interrupts = <13 4 5>;
 	#address-cells = <1>;
 	#size-cells = <0>;
+	clocks = <&spi1_clk>;
+	clock-names = "spi_clk";
 	cs-gpios = <&pioB 3 0>;
 	status = "okay";
